Christmas Midnight Mass, ABC
• Responsorial Psalm
R. (Lk 2:11) Today is born our Savior, Christ the Lord.
Ps. 96: 1-2, 2-3, 11-12, 13

R. Today is born our Savior, Christ the Lord.
      Sing to the LORD a new song;
      sing to the LORD, all you lands.
      Sing to the LORD; bless his name.
R. Today is born our Savior, Christ the Lord.
      Announce his salvation, day after day.
      Tell his glory among the nations;
      among all peoples, his wondrous deeds.
R. Today is born our Savior, Christ the Lord.
      Let the heavens be glad and the earth rejoice;
      let the sea and what fills it resound;
      let the plains be joyful and all that is in them!
      Then shall all the trees of the forest exult.
R. Today is born our Savior, Christ the Lord.
      They shall exult before the LORD, for he comes;
      for he comes to rule the earth.
      He shall rule the world with justice
      and the peoples with his constancy.
R. Today is born our Savior, Christ the Lord.

Hódie natus est nobis Salvátor, qui est Christus Dóminus.
